About The Opportunity

In your role as an Apprentice Electrician you will focus on learning and developing electrical trade skills in order to use those skills to provide quality support to Bundaberg Regional Council. You will assist in the provision of electrical maintenance for Council buildings, properties, Water and Wastewater facilities and associated equipment, in a safe and efficient manner while completing the requirements of a Certificate III in Electrotechnology Electrician.
